Animation Industry India Report ( http://www.bharatbook.com/Market-Research-Reports/Animation-Industry-India.html ) covering the animation industry. The report is part of Entertainment and Media Industry series. Animation market in India is estimated to be worth USD 460 mn in 2008 and is expected to reach USD 1,192 mn by 2012. Animation sector comprises of education, multimedia/web design, entertainment and custom content development.

a knowledge consulting solutions company, announces the launch of its report – Animation Market – India. India has become an outsourcing hub for animation work with large number of international media companies entering into joint ventures with animation studios in India. Increase in number of institutions providing professional animation courses, surge in demand for animated content in domestic market and character licensing business is creating  tremendous growth opportunities for animation studios in India.

The report provides a brief overview of the Indian animation industry including market size, growth and key segments. Analysis of drivers reveals that growing demand for animated content in the domestic market, cost arbitrage opportunity in India, improving animation education and increasing character licensing business have helped growth of this sector in India. The key challenges identified include high set-up and production cost, talent shortage and lack of protection of intellectual property. The future trends identified include increasing animation application in other sectors, domestic animation movies earning revenues through international releases and increase in investments and realizations for animated movies in India.

The competition section profiles the major animation studios in India including their business overview and work portfolio. The report also identifies key developments in the animation sector in India.

Multiplex India ( http://www.bharatbook.com/Market-Research-Reports/Multiplex-India.html ) provides complete picture of Multiplex Industry market in India.
 
 The cinema exhibition industry in India is growing at 10% per annum driven by multiplexes, which are expanding rapidly in major metropolitan cities as well as second and third tier cities. Favorable demographics in a cinema-crazy nation, tax exemptions, and quality locations such as malls, are driving growth of multiplexes in India.
 
 The report provides a snapshot of the market including the two segments multiplexes and single screen cinemas. An overview gives a quick picture of the market with estimated market size, growth rate and theatre distribution in India. Various business models adopted by Indian multiplex operators are presented along with typical revenue streams and cost base. An analysis of drivers reveals that on the supply side – growth in film industry, improving real estate supply, and favourable tax exemptions have help in growth of this sector while on the demand side favourable demographics, rising income levels and willingness of people to spend on entertainment are increasing footfalls. The key challenges identified include slowdown in economy, alternate modes of entertainment, development delays, piracy and uncertainty over entertainment tax exemptions.
 
 The industry is characterized by seasonality, low screen density, increasing average ticket prices, and reducing shelf life of movies. The key trends identified include producers bypassing distributors, shift to digital cinema, and alternate content in multiplexes, retail partnerships, and new single screen formats. The competitive landscape identifies and compares the major multiplex operators in the market since they dominate an industry where single screen cinemas are highly fragmented. Comparison parameters include number of screens, number of cinemas, footfalls and occupancy ratio.
